I discussed with Shilpa and got to know that zone rename command information had to be added in 'radosgw-admin --help' command output, not in man page.

As required information on 'zone rename' has been added in 'radosgw-admin --help', moving bug to VERIFIED state.

----------------------------------------

$ sudo radosgw-admin --help |grep zone
  zone create                create a new zone
  zone delete                delete a zone
  zone get                   show zone cluster params
  zone modify                modify an existing zone
  zone set                   set zone cluster params (requires infile)
  zone list                  list all zones set on this cluster
  zone rename                rename a zone

----------------------------------------
